A struggling Chicago man with mob ties and his 10-year-old daughter nurse a wounded Doberman - used for illegal dog fights - back to health. But trouble awaits.
John Travolta stars as single parent Bobby, struggling to bring up his daughter (Ellie Raab). Only released on the coat-tails of its star's post-Pulp Fiction comeback, this violent story follows Raab as she nurses a mobster's injured Doberman back to health, not realising that her involvement with the pooch will have her and Travolta fleeing Chicago. The dog, of course, makes an implausible road trip of its own to find its nice new mistress, with Mafia heavies in hot pursuit. It really is no surprise to learn this movie failed to find a distributor for four years.
